What kind of camera do I need?

Bring any camera or even none at all. Phone cameras work fine at this meetup.

Alternatively bring your DSLRs or Mirrorless camera. Want to bring a film camera? Please do.

In fact, bring any camera or even no camera. I don't have any cameras for rent or to lend. However, you're more than welcome to join us. If you just want to explore nature with us then come on out.

What Does It Cost To Join?

The nature photo meetups are free. However, donations (and tips) are gladly accepted. Generally speaking, many of the participants choose to donate anywhere from $5 to $50. On average most people give $20 either when buying the ticket or in the form of a tip as they're leaving.

The History of the Pittsburgh Photographers: Nature Photo Meetup

Since 2020 I've hosted the nature photography meetup. Life began to normalize during the pandemic. However, we didn't have vaccines yet. So, I was looking for a way to socialize. Plus, I needed to lose the weight I was putting on supporting my local restaurants. My wife Zhanna and I were already doing regular non-photo walks in Frick Park near our home.

With this being the case I decided that it made sense to invite others along on nature photography walks through Frick Park.

Weekly Nature Photo Walks

I started sharing information about weekly nature photo walks in Frick Park on Facebook. As these were sometimes well attended I knew I needed to inform people through other channels. As a result, I began to use Eventbrite.

Eventually, after the vaccines were rolled out events and other photography jobs meant that my availability to lead weekly walks was over. However, I decided to continue offering these walks monthly.

Monthly Photo Walks

I transitioned to monthly photo walks in 2022. As a result, turnout improved. I began to see more regulars. Too, I began to accept donations to help continue doing the administrative work of hosting the walks.

One attendee expressed that we hadn't walked enough was was disappointing. As a result, I changed the title from "walks" to "meetups" to prevent confusion.
